About iShares Global Tech ETF

IXN provides exposure to global electronics, software, and hardware companies. It tracks the S&P Global 1200 Information Technology Index, covering tech leaders across both developed and emerging markets.

About ProShares Ultra Gold ETF

UGL is a leveraged ETF that seeks daily investment results, before fees and expenses, that correspond to two times (2x) the daily performance of the Bloomberg Gold Subindex. It is a tactical tool designed for sophisticated investors to magnify short-term bullish views on gold prices through the use of futures and swap contracts, rather than holding physical bullion.
